news 2026/4/14 12:55:10

从零开始:如何用Harepacker-resurrected轻松定制你的MapleStory游戏世界

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
从零开始:如何用Harepacker-resurrected轻松定制你的MapleStory游戏世界

从零开始:如何用Harepacker-resurrected轻松定制你的MapleStory游戏世界

【免费下载链接】Harepacker-resurrectedAll in one .wz file/map editor for MapleStory game files项目地址: https://gitcode.com/gh_mirrors/ha/Harepacker-resurrected

还在为MapleStory游戏中一成不变的角色形象和地图场景感到乏味吗?是否曾想过亲手打造一个独一无二的游戏世界,却因复杂的WZ文件格式望而却步?Harepacker-resurrected正是为你解决这一难题的终极工具集,让游戏资源编辑变得像搭积木一样简单直观。这个开源项目集成了HaCreator地图编辑器和HaRepacker WZ文件编辑器两大核心模块,为MapleStory爱好者提供了完整的资源定制解决方案。

核心问题:为什么游戏资源编辑如此困难?

MapleStory的游戏资源采用加密的WZ文件格式存储,这些文件包含了游戏中所有的图像、声音、地图和角色数据。传统的编辑方式需要深入理解复杂的文件结构、掌握专业的编程知识,甚至要破解加密算法。对于大多数玩家来说,这无疑是一道难以逾越的技术门槛。

更让人头疼的是,即使你成功解开了文件,如何直观地编辑游戏元素?如何确保修改后的资源能在游戏中正常显示?这些问题常常让初学者在尝试几次后就选择放弃。


解决方案:一站式可视化编辑平台

Harepacker-resurrected通过两大核心模块解决了这些难题:

HaCreator地图编辑器提供了直观的拖拽式界面,让你可以像使用Photoshop一样编辑游戏地图。无论是添加新的NPC、调整地形布局,还是创建全新的游戏场景,一切操作都变得可视化且易于理解。

HaRepacker WZ文件编辑器则专注于WZ文件的解析和修改。它支持多种加密版本的自动识别,内置批量处理功能,让你能够高效地管理大量游戏资源文件。

Harepacker-resurrected支持的角色特效编辑功能,展示如何为角色添加华丽的视觉特效

实践路径:三步开启你的游戏创作之旅

第一步:环境搭建与项目获取

开始前,你需要准备Visual Studio 2022开发环境和Git工具。通过以下命令获取项目源码:

git clone https://gitcode.com/gh_mirrors/ha/Harepacker-resurrected

克隆完成后,打开项目根目录下的MapleHaSuite.sln文件,这是整个工具集的解决方案文件。根据你的需求,可以将HaCreator或HaRepacker设置为启动项目。

第二步:核心功能快速上手

角色外观定制是许多玩家最感兴趣的功能。在HaCreator中,你可以轻松修改角色的服饰颜色、发型搭配,甚至添加专属特效。项目中的HaCreator/MapEditor/Instance目录包含了各种游戏对象的实例编辑器,让你能够精确控制每个元素的属性。

地图场景创作则更加直观。通过HaCreator/GUI/EditorPanels中的各种面板,你可以添加平台、设置立足点、布置NPC和怪物。实时预览功能让你在编辑过程中就能看到最终效果,大大减少了调试时间。

WZ文件批量处理对于需要修改大量资源的用户来说至关重要。HaRepacker支持批量解包、编辑和重新打包,你可以在HaRepacker/GUI/Panels中找到各种专门设计的编辑面板,针对不同类型的游戏资源提供针对性的编辑界面。

第三步:常见问题应对策略

文件加密问题是最常见的障碍。HaRepacker内置了多种解密算法,能够自动识别并处理不同版本的WZ加密。如果遇到无法打开的文件,可以尝试在HaRepacker/GUI/Input目录下的加密设置面板中调整参数。

资源兼容性问题也经常困扰用户。修改后的资源需要在游戏中正常显示,这要求你了解游戏客户端的版本兼容性。项目文档docs/wz-format/中详细介绍了不同版本的文件格式差异,帮助你避免兼容性问题。

Harepacker-resurrected处理的游戏特效资源,展示蓝白渐变的光效和能量粒子效果

进阶技巧:打造专业级游戏内容

特效资源制作全流程

从基础的光效到复杂的粒子系统,Harepacker-resurrected提供了完整的特效制作工具链。通过RealESRGAN_AI_Upscale模块,你甚至可以利用AI技术提升图像质量,让低分辨率资源焕然一新。

特效制作的关键在于理解游戏引擎的渲染机制。项目中的HaSharedLibrary/Render目录包含了DirectX渲染相关的代码,帮助你理解游戏如何显示各种视觉效果。

交互式元素配置技巧

想要让地图更加生动?添加可交互的机关和触发器是关键。在HaCreator/MapEditor/AI目录中,你可以找到AI相关的配置工具,为NPC和怪物设置智能行为模式。

通过组合不同的参数设置,你可以创造出令人惊叹的视觉效果和丰富的游戏体验。无论是简单的开关门机制,还是复杂的任务触发系统,一切都在你的掌控之中。

持续学习与社区支持

Harepacker-resurrected是一个活跃的开源项目,拥有完善的文档体系和活跃的社区支持。项目中的docs/目录包含了从基础使用到高级开发的完整文档:

  • docs/wz-format/详细解释了WZ文件的结构和加密机制
  • docs/hacreator-harepacker-architecture/介绍了整个工具集的架构设计
  • docs/mapsimulator/提供了地图模拟器的技术分析

如果你在开发过程中遇到问题,可以查阅这些文档寻找解决方案。项目的模块化设计也使得扩展功能变得相对容易,你可以在现有基础上添加自己的定制功能。


总结:开启你的创意之旅

通过Harepacker-resurrected,MapleStory的资源编辑不再是专业人士的专利。无论你是想微调角色外观,还是打造全新的游戏地图,这个工具集都能为你提供强大的支持。

记住,创意没有边界,技术只是实现创意的工具。现在就开始使用Harepacker-resurrected,将你的想象力转化为游戏中的现实,打造一个真正属于你的MapleStory世界!

【免费下载链接】Harepacker-resurrectedAll in one .wz file/map editor for MapleStory game files项目地址: https://gitcode.com/gh_mirrors/ha/Harepacker-resurrected

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/14 12:54:10

5分钟极速上手:PPTist在线编辑器的终极安装指南

5分钟极速上手:PPTist在线编辑器的终极安装指南 【免费下载链接】PPTist PowerPoint-ist(/pauəpɔintist/), An online presentation application that replicates most of the commonly used features of MS PowerPoint, allowing for the …

作者头像 李华
网站建设 2026/4/14 12:51:49

终极指南:BeeHive如何将Spring理念完美融入iOS架构开发

终极指南:BeeHive如何将Spring理念完美融入iOS架构开发 【免费下载链接】BeeHive alibaba/BeeHive: 阿里巴巴开发的 Hadoop 自动化作业平台。特点是提供了一个可视化的界面,可以方便地管理 Hadoop 集群作业和资源。 项目地址: https://gitcode.com/gh_…

作者头像 李华
网站建设 2026/4/14 12:49:24

Nunchaku FLUX.1-dev镜像免配置:支持WebUI+API+CLI三接口交付

Nunchaku FLUX.1-dev镜像免配置:支持WebUIAPICLI三接口交付 想体验最新的FLUX.1-dev文生图模型,但被复杂的安装配置劝退?今天给大家介绍一个“开箱即用”的解决方案——Nunchaku FLUX.1-dev镜像。这个镜像最大的特点就是免配置,它…

作者头像 李华